Akbaruddin Owaisi arrested in hate speech case

Tuesday January 08, 2013 07:21:47 PM, IANS

Hyderabad: Majlis-e-Ittehadul Muslimeen (MIM) leader Akbaruddin Owaisi was arrested Tuesday in a case booked against him for delivering alleged hate speeches.

After undergoing medical tests through the day at government-run Gandhi Hospital, the legislator was arrested by police. The medical tests showed that he is fit to face the questioning.

Police said Akbar Owaisi is being shifted to Nirmal town in Adilabad district, about 200 km from here, for questioning.
